{"title":"Performance Evaluation of Vertically Stacked Nanosheet InGaAs/InAlAs/InP Double Quantum Well FinFET on Si Substrate","authors":"Erry Dwi Kurniawan, Yan-Ting Du, Yung-Chun Wu","doi":"10.1109/ICRAMET51080.2020.9298683","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/ICRAMET51080.2020.9298683","url":null,"abstract":"We study the performance of vertically stacked InGaAs/InAlAs/InP Double Quantum Well (DQW) Fin Field Effect Transistor (FinFET) on Si substrate using threedimensional Technology Computer-Aided Design (TCAD) simulation. In0.53Ga0.47As and In0.52Al0.48As are used as the quantum well channel and the barrier material, respectively. Both materials are lattice matched to the InP buffer layer material on Si substrate. The device is simulated with gate lengths (LG) of 15 nm and gate stack (Al2O3/HfO2) of 1nm/2nm (EOT~0.75nm). The simulation results reveal that by using double channel quantum well (super lattice structure) can enhance the saturation current up to 24% compared to Single Quantum Well (SQW) device. The maximum capacitance of the DQW also outperforms the SQW FinFET approximately 34%. The higher capacitance indicates the higher carrier density. The electron density of DQW prefers to localize in the InGaAs layer as the quantum well channel, thus allow greater control over the electron behavior. The proposed antenna has a rectangular slot with a hexagonal slot being placed in the inner conducting element. The antenna is fed through a 50Ω microstrip feed line placed on the other side of the substrate. The resonant frequency is controlled by changing the capacitance value of the varactor diode place between the two conducting elements providing a various range of resonance frequencies, frequency bands, and different bandwidths. The suggested slot antenna is simulated using the Ansys Electronics Desktop simulator (HFSS). The reflection coefficient shows the quad frequency bands cover (2.31 − 2.5), (2.9 − 3.27), (4.28 − 5.23), and (5.4 − 5.74) GHz. Liao","doi":"10.1109/ICRAMET51080.2020.9298624","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/ICRAMET51080.2020.9298624","url":null,"abstract":"A broadband, high gain microstrip Yagi antenna operating at 28GHz and targeting on 5G applications is presented in this paper. The antenna is composed of a printed dipole with improved performance and three directors. Getting benefits from arc chamfering and bow tie structure, the antenna shows broadened bandwidth compared to conventional microstrip Yagi antennas. Next, an array which consists of eight linear arranged proposed antennas is designed and simulated. Fed by an unequal microstrip power divider, the array exhibits a fractional -10dB impedance bandwidth of 46.4% at 28GHz, a stable gain of higher than 15dBi and a low sidelobe level of -19.2dB in the operating frequency band.","PeriodicalId":228482,"journal":{"name":"2020 International Conference on Radar, Antenna, Microwave, Electronics, and Telecommunications (ICRAMET)","volume":"15 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-11-18","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"132784282","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Conventional methods have been proposed using multiple image registration, intrinsic and extrinsic camera parameter estimation, and optimization methods. Recently, the availability of a 3D dataset publicly shared has encouraged a deep-learning-based method for single-view reconstruction. One approach was by employing direct image encoding to the 3D point decoding approach as in PointNet and AtlasNet. Some other research directions attempted to retrieve 3D data using deep-learning-based methods, which employed a convolutional neural network (CNN). However, the use of CNN in image classification specific for the 3D reconstruction task still needs to be investigated because, usually, CNN was used as an image encoder in an auto-encoder setting instead of a classification module in a point generation network. Moreover, there is a lack of reports on the performance evaluation of deep-learning-based method on images rendered from 3D data, such as ShapeNet rendering images. In this paper, we implemented several deep-learning models to decode the ShapeNet rendering images that contain 13 model categories to examine the various hyper-parameters' impacts on each 3D model category. Our experiments showed that the hyper-parameters of the learning rate and epochs set to either 0.001 or 0.0001 and 60-80 epochs significantly outperformed other settings. Moreover, we observed that regardless of network configuration, some categories (plane, watercraft, car) performed better throughout the study.
